Default help with concept 600 (clifford)

just picked up my first impreza turbo on a 03 plate and its already got a clifford concept 600 fitted but the numptys and the garge i got it from had troubles with it going off all the time because they were to lazy to read the instructions to see how you put it in valet mode. now because they pressed all the buttons on the key fob plus tried takin the battery off. Now some of its features aren't working. proximity sensors have stopped working auto lock has stopped working + it doesn't chirp when you lock or unlock plus more just cant remember them all. anyone know how i can get them working again without takin it to a clifford specialist

take it to a specialist and get a health check done on it + ask them to program the options you require. It should cost no more than £30 and you will know that its all working fine
